Procedure using HTTP interface for Package C ONTs
Package C ONTs support limited configuration using a web-based GUI. The ONT
must support an HTTP server, and the computer must have a supported HTTP client
(Web browser).
The following procedures provide the steps to access the HTTP interface.

Procedures using CLI interface for Package C ONTs
The CLI interface for Package C ONTs is accessible in two ways:
craft port—The CLI interface is accessible through a craft port, which is provided
by some ONT models. You connect to the craft port with an RS-232 DB-9
connector, using a VT100 terminal or PC terminal emulation software set at 9600
Baud, 8 bits, no parity.
Ethernet over LAN—The CLI interface is accessible through an Ethernet port on
an ONT using a computer or laptop with Telnet software.
The following procedures provide the steps to access and to disconnect from the CLI
interface using a craft port, or an Ethernet port.

Open a web browser and enter the IP address of the ONT in the address bar.
The login window appears.
The default gateway IP address is http://192.168.50.101. You can also obtain the
IP address using DHCP after connecting your PC to the layer 3 UNI.
Enter your username and password in the Login window.
The default username is root while the default password is admin.
Note — If you forget the current username and password, press the
reset button for 5 s and the default values for the username and
password will be recovered upon start up.
Click OK.
STOP. This procedure is complete.
